CVE-2018-5544 : Exploit Details and Defense Strategies

Learn about CVE-2018-5544 affecting F5 Networks, Inc.'s BIG-IP (APM) versions 13.0.0-13.1.1 and 12.1.0-12.1.3, leading to an information disclosure vulnerability through URI parameters.

CVE-2018-5544 was published on July 30, 2018, and affects F5 Networks, Inc.'s BIG-IP (APM) versions 13.0.0-13.1.1 and 12.1.0-12.1.3. The vulnerability could lead to unintentional exposure of configuration details during the rendering process of specific pages.

Understanding CVE-2018-5544

This CVE involves an information disclosure vulnerability in F5 BIG-IP APM versions 13.0.0-13.1.1 and 12.1.0-12.1.3, potentially exposing configuration details through URI parameters.

What is CVE-2018-5544?

When rendering certain pages with a logon agent or a confirm box, the affected F5 BIG-IP APM versions may inadvertently reveal configuration information like partition and agent names via URI parameters.

The Impact of CVE-2018-5544

The vulnerability could allow unauthorized parties to access sensitive configuration details, posing a risk to the confidentiality of the affected systems.

Technical Details of CVE-2018-5544

This section provides more in-depth technical insights into the vulnerability.

Vulnerability Description

The vulnerability in F5 BIG-IP APM versions 13.0.0-13.1.1 and 12.1.0-12.1.3 could result in the exposure of configuration details, including partition and agent names, through URI parameters.

Affected Systems and Versions

        Product: BIG-IP (APM)
        Vendor: F5 Networks, Inc.
        Versions: 13.0.0-13.1.1, 12.1.0-12.1.3

Exploitation Mechanism

The vulnerability occurs during the rendering process of specific pages that contain a logon agent or a confirm box, leading to the unintentional exposure of configuration details.
